But enough fan-girling, my big questions actually regard the Flash family:
Did Barry Allen have any influence on Wally's (and Artemis') decision to leave the hero "life" behind?
Was Barry always a study science over speed kind of guy?
I may be wrong but didn't Barry disapprove of Wally gaining super speed powers in the beginning and is he happy that he's left the life?
Can Wally get "out of shape" speed-wise since hes at college and does that effect his acceleration or top-speed in any way?
That is all. Thank you for your time!
1. Not directly, no.
2. Basically.
3. Barry wasn't looking for a sidekick and initially accepted Wally out of guilt when Wally nearly blew himself up getting his powers. But Barry came to appreciate Kid Flash with time. On the other hand, I'm sure he appreciated Wally and Artemis' decision.
4. I don't think he's let himself go but theoretically yes.

You mentioned before that the main reason for the lack of women in the Leauge was primarily due to lack of source material, ie. not many female Leaugers to choose from...but what about Vixen, Gipsi, Dr. Light, Fire and Ice, who are all established Leaugers through many incarnations, much more so than Rocket (which is not to say that I dont enjoy Rocket in the show, because I definatley do).
Were these charicters not considered? Just not fit into your timeline? Some other reason?
If any were simply never considered, why not?
It seems that not including any of them is a missed opportunity for diversity on multiple levels.
We wanted to begin in Season One with a League that was both highly iconic and quite powerful.
After that, we had plans for some of the members you named.
